How did women help improve conditions for soldiers?

Respuesta :

abader abader
  • 06-08-2017
The women were nurses who provided care for wounded soldiers. They would also clean up and cook for the soldiers, which helped with conditions. Not only that, but in terms of mentally, the presence of a woman was "relaxing", and sometimes females provided entertainment.
